“…Among these tools, IES-VE is a popular commercial software used worldwide including China [55]. The validation and accuracy of this software have been proven by the BESTEST (Building Energy Simulation Test) standard of the International Energy Agency (IEA), green building rating schemes and amounts of existing studies [56][57][58][59]. Moreover, it has extensive capabilities for modeling customize systems and controls, which allows for the simulation of the intermittent operation mode of air conditioners in the case study.…”
